The dollar is under pressure ahead of Kevin Warsh's first FOMC meeting as Fed chair, with markets uncertain about his policy stance and rate path. The meeting creates a binary catalyst: a hawkish surprise could sharply lift the dollar while any dovish lean or rate cut signal accelerates the recent softening trend.

Bull caseUUP · UDN · FXE

Warsh's longstanding hawkish reputation and emphasis on Fed credibility could translate into a hold or restrictive signal that anchors the dollar and reverses recent weakness.

Bear caseUUP · UDN · FXE

If Warsh bows to growth concerns or political pressure and signals an easing bias in his debut, the dollar could accelerate its downtrend as markets reprice the terminal rate lower.
